The project format changed. Now, files in the directory are automatically included in the project. This makes Modlr unable to find them in the project file, and Codegen has become sketchy.

Add this to Project:

  <EnableDefaultCompileItems>false</EnableDefaultCompileItems>
</PropertyGroup>

Also, make sure you have this dependency on files:

<Compile Update="EcoProject1\Class3.eco.cs">
  <DependentUpon>Class3.cs</DependentUpon>
</Compile>

This should be fixed in FW.
